However, if socializing as well as using your voice as a main tool for work is not your main thing at all, then you may consider any of these ten jobs which are best done alone.

Automotive service technician

The reason why this is quiet is that people who fall under these profession tend to spend most of their time under the hood. Of course, there are those short conversations with the car owners. But after that, it is all about cars and their inner components. Their salary goes to about $37,622 per year.

The cost estimator

The one thing that cost estimators do is to analyze blueprint designs and proposals, as well as determining the cost of a project from start to finish. They try to lessen costs on materials, labor, location and duration as much as possible. They earn about $53,413 yearly.

Librarian

First of all, libraries is off-limits to talking and chatting. Therefore, you get to spend most of your time organizing and maintaining materials and publications. Most of the time, you have to usher people to any of the sections found in the library. Librarians at about $48,025 per year.

The interior designer

They spend most of their time alone, decorating and meeting their clients to meet their needs. Interior designers often choose the style and color palettes, furniture, as well as the artwork and lighting. They either work as consultants or are self-employed. They earni around $45,524 every year.

Medical transcriptionist

This kind of occupation does not allow you to talk. You only listen. The only thing that you do here is to transcribe or copy a certain transcription recorded and made by physicians and health-care professionals. They then transform those information into medical reports. Their salary: $31,251 a year.

Network systems analyst

The only thing these guys do is to design, test and evaluate computer systems. Examples of what these guys handle are local area networks, wide area networks, intranets and the Internet itself. Since networks are now expanding, telecommuting is frequent among computer professionals because of unavailability of networks in distant locations. Their yearly salary is $40,830 per year.

Survey researcher

Instead of interviewing people face to face, they create and conduct surveys through the Internet. Usually, they write reports, prepare and study charts, and survey the results. Their salary goes up to $27,478 a year.

Undertaker

Aside from having to communicate with family of the deceased, you get to work in silence since your job has everything to do with the dead. Unless the dead people themselves talk to you. The salary undertakers usually earn per year goes at about $42,280.

Writers-authors and technical writers

It is true that writers as well as authors need some peace to do their tasks. For technical writers, they need all the peace they can get in order to get those scientific information transformed into layman's words. Writers and authors earn at approximately $42,790 every year. Technical writers earn at about $55,710 yearly.
